Key Elements of Effective NDAs in the Gaming Industry
Effective NDAs in the gaming industry must clearly identify the confidential information to be protected, such as game mechanics, code, artwork, and proprietary algorithms. Specificity helps prevent ambiguity and ensures enforceability.
Additionally, these agreements should define the duration of confidentiality obligations, aligning with project phases and anticipated proprietary lifespan. Precise timeframes mitigate risks of indefinite restrictions, which can hinder collaboration.
The scope of the NDA should encompass all relevant parties, including developers, contractors, and third-party collaborators, to establish comprehensive confidentiality measures. Clear obligations and restrictions help manage expectations and enforce legal compliance.
Finally, incorporating explicit penalties for breaches enhances efficacy. Penalties, such as financial fines or legal remedies, serve as deterrents and clarify the importance of confidentiality in video game development. Properly drafted NDAs protect intellectual property while fostering secure collaboration.

Tailoring NDAs to Project Phases
Tailoring NDAs to the various project phases in video game development ensures that confidentiality measures remain relevant and effective throughout the entire process. Each phase presents unique information security needs, requiring specific provisions within the NDA.
For example, during the pre-production phase, NDAs should focus on protecting initial concept art, design documents, and early prototypes. As development progresses to the production stage, the NDA should expand to include source code, technical specifications, and assets.
In the testing and release phases, NDAs must restrict access to proprietary game mechanics, marketing strategies, and unreleased content. This phased approach helps to prevent leaks at critical points, safeguarding intellectual property and competitive advantage.
Key components of tailoring NDAs to project phases include:
- Defining clear scope for each phase,
- Updating confidentiality obligations accordingly,
- Incorporating specific penalties for breaches relevant to each stage of development.
Including Penalties for Breach of Confidentiality
Including penalties for breach of confidentiality is a vital component of effective NDAs in video game development. Clearly specified penalties serve as a deterrent by emphasizing the seriousness of confidentiality obligations. They also provide a legal framework for addressing breaches when they occur.
Well-drafted penalties typically include monetary damages, injunctive relief, and sometimes liquidated damages. These stipulations help limit disputes over damages and clarify consequences ahead of time. Accurate and enforceable penalties reduce legal ambiguity and encourage compliance.
Additionally, defining the scope and limits of penalties within the NDA ensures they are proportionate and enforceable under applicable laws. Overly severe or vague penalties may be challenged in court, undermining the agreement’s effectiveness. Precise language safeguards both the disclosing party and the recipient.
Incorporating specific penalties within the NDA aligns with best practices in the gaming industry, where confidentiality breaches can have significant financial and reputational impacts. Proper penalties reinforce the importance of confidentiality in safeguarding intellectual property and project integrity.

Integrating Confidentiality Measures into the Development Workflow
Integrating confidentiality measures into the development workflow involves embedding legal and procedural safeguards at every stage of game creation. This process helps prevent accidental disclosures and reinforces the importance of confidentiality among team members.
First, establishing clear access controls ensures that sensitive information is only available to authorized personnel. This minimizes the risk of leaks by restricting data distribution within secure platforms or encrypted channels.
Second, regular training sessions educate developers and collaborators on confidentiality obligations and best practices, fostering a culture of awareness and responsibility. This proactive approach supports the effective implementation of NDAs and confidentiality policies.
Third, integrating confidentiality checkpoints into project management tools aligns privacy measures with development milestones. These checkpoints ensure ongoing compliance and enable swift intervention if breaches are detected.
Overall, systematic integration of confidentiality measures into the development workflow is vital for protecting strategic assets and maintaining legal compliance in the gaming industry.
